Minimum inhibitory concentrations of amphotericin B, azoles and caspofungin against Candida species are reduced by farnesol

Abstract

The objective of this study was to evaluate the antifungal activity of farnesol and its interaction with traditional antifungals against drug-resistant strains of Candida species. To do so, we studied the minimum in vitro inhibitory concentration (MIC) of amphotericin B (AMB), fluconazole (FLC), itraconazole (ITC), caspofungin (CAS) and farnesol against 45 isolates of Candida spp., i.e., 24 C. albicans, 16 C. parapsilosis and 5 C. tropicalis through the use of the broth microdilution method. Then, the isolates were tested with the combination of farnesol plus drugs to which they were previously found to be resistant. Additionally, the strains were pre-incubated at sub-inhibitory farnesol concentrations and their antifungal susceptibilities were re-evaluated. We found the MIC values for farnesol varied from 4.68–150 µM for Candida spp., with 19 isolates having a MIC > 1 mg/l, 18 a MIC ≥ 64 mg/l, 35 having a MIC ≥ 1 mg/l and 6 isolates a MIC ≥ 2 mg/l or were resistant to AMB, FLC, ITC and CAS, respectively. Significant MIC reductions were observed when farnesol and antifungal drugs were combined (P < 0.05) and when Candida strains were incubated with farnesol (P < 0.05). We conclude that the in vitro effects of farnesol improved the activity of traditional antifungals to which the Candida spp. isolates were resistant. These results support further investigation of the role of farnesol in the balance of the sterol biosynthetic pathway and how it interferes with cell viability.
